In Ingglish — phonetic English where every spelling always makes the same sound — the word “prospers” is spelled “prosperz”. Here is how it sounds out, one sound at a time:
| Ingglish | p | r | o | s | p | er | z |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| IPA | /p/ | /ɹ/ | /ɑ/ | /s/ | /p/ | /ɝ/ | /z/ |
English writes “prospers” with
8 letters for 7 sounds. Ingglish writes it
“prosperz” — no silent letters, and the same spelling
always makes the same sound, so you can read it exactly as it looks.
